Which term is used to describe the modeling of light to bright areas, includes the rendering of halftones, and casts shadows wit
ad-work [718]

Answer:

The correct answer is Chiaroscuro.

Explanation:

When strong contrasts between light and dark, usually bold contrasts affecting a whole composition is utilized by an artist he or she is said to be using Chiaroscuro technique.

It was invented by Leonardo da Vinci.

In italian, the word Chiaroscuro refers to light and shadow. When you see a painting of an object of a person with an illusion of light falling at same from an angle, you are most likely looking at the Chiaroscuro technique.

This technique also creates an illusion that one is looking at three-dimensional objects and figures. It gives a sense of volume in modelling.

Some of the prominent artists who used the Chiaroscuro technique are:

  • Caravaggio
  • Georges de La Tour
  • Hendrick ter Brugghen and so on.

The technique is also used in photography and motion picture.
